Guaifenesin Protocol for Fibromyalgia by Paul St. Amand, M.D.
The Protocol consists of:
1. Reading his book (to know the correct dosage for you, to know what specifically to avoid,
and to know what will happen).
2. Taking Guaifenesin
3. Avoiding salicylates
4. Low Carb Diet
In his book, "What Your Doctor May Not Tell You About Fibromyalgia: The Revolutionary Treatment
That Can Reverse the Disease" Paul St. Amand, M.D. writes about how he discovered that the
drug guaifenesin can actually give patients the possibility of reversing fibromyalgia. However, for
guaifenesin to work, one must eliminate all sources of salicylates (a chemical compound
that blocks the effectiveness of guaifenesin.) Salicylates can be found in many common things
that people use. He calls his method of reversing fibromyalgia, "the guaifenesin protocol."
Dr. St. Amand also speaks about how the initial stages of taking guaifenesin
are the most horrible as the body cleanses itself (the sufferer will begin to
question whether the drug is actually working). However, it is the later stages
of taking guaifenisin whereby Dr. St. Amand states that the person's fibromyalgia
begins to dissipate.

I heard of the guai protocol around 2001. I tried it for a while, and found it really didn't help my symptoms, and it was a hassle. Perhaps because I didn't do the protocol under a doctor's care?
First off, FINDING it at that time was hard. I had to buy it online. Nowadays, it CAN be purchased at many local stores, so it isn't as difficult now.
Also, something that "they" never mention - for the protocol to work best, you must remove ALL sources of alpha and beta Hydroxies - AND salicylates! Beyond "no aspirin", I was reading labels and seeking all sources of these in my life. Hair and skin products, foods, medicines, supplements - this stuff was EVERYWHERE! It was HARD WORK to find it and not take it in! Salicylates seemed to be in or on everything, and I wanted NONE in my life so the treatment would be effective.
Even after doing that, I really didn't notice any marked improvement in my symptoms, pain and exhaustion remained. Flares remained. All the other little symptoms such as brutal hangnails and thick phlegm, surprisingly, remained.
So although it isn't expensive, and not as difficult to do nowadays, I find it doesn't help my form of fibro. YMMV, and good luck to you!
